XLK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2014 in Review

523 of the 3,751 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street Technology Select Sector SPDR ETF (XLK) for Q4 2014, worth a combined $7.49B — down 8.6% from $8.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 95 funds opened new XLK positions and 28 closed out — a net gain of 67 holders — while 218 added to existing stakes and 144 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Nomura Holdings, adding an estimated $151M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$1.07B.
